My 88 22re recently quit on me while driving. It always started again but would only run for 2 or 3 seconds, then sputter and die (had to have it towed home). No engine codes. I let it sit for over a week, replaced the fuel pressure regulator, then it started and ran perfectly. I drove it a few miles to the store. When I started it to go home, it did the same thing; started, ran for 2 or 3 seconds, then died - several times. After waiting a few minutes it started and I was able to rev it enough that it pushed through the sputtering, ran fine, and got me home. Now I'm paranoid to take it out anywhere as it seems to do this randomly. Don't think it would be the fuel pump or it wouldn't run at all - right? Any thoughts?

With no codes, it is either a mechanical issue, or the failing electronic component has failed enough to trigger a code. Might start with the fuel system, replace the filter and possibly the pump. May want to pull and test/clean the injectors, check youtube for a DIY video. From there start testing ignition components and the air flow sensor, in my experience if/when the components are near their extreme ends of their operating ranges, they are usually the issue. Thanks. Replaced the fuel pressure regulator, fuel pump, and fuel filter. It will start and keeping running now, and idles fairly steady. However, it will randomly flutter and die at idle. Most of the time I can give it some gas and keep it running. The randomness mystifies me.
